What is my SBI kit number?

This ‘Kit Number’ can be found on the back side of the page containing the username and password, according to SBI. After entering the kit number, check the ‘I accept the Terms and Conditions’ option at the bottom of the form and click on the ‘Submit’ button to proceed.

How can I get Internet banking kit?

Download the registration form to apply for Internet Banking facility. Complete and submit the form to the branch where you hold an account. The Branch Officer will guide you through the registration process and will issue the Internet Banking Kit.

How do I know my SBI CIF no?

You can call SBI customer care team at the toll-free numbers – 1800112211, 18004253800 or, 080-26599990 – any time to know the CIF number. You will need to share your account information to verify your identity.

What does Kit no mean on a bank account?

KIT No. means the number Printed on the Face of the cover, which contains the default login password for internet banking access for the first time. While logging in for the first time for Internet Banking, customer is required to mention the number appearing on the Kit, to get access to the Internet Banking Services.

What to do if you lost your SBI Login Kit?

Hence if you have lost the kit,kindly go to the branch and ask the desk officer for a new kit,but remember the username for you will be the same as in the old kit,the desk officer will tell you the username and you have to login in with username from old kit and password from the new one given to you.
